Transaction 58254e1433244d1fd9599358611a5288a29dd70cf01b442b5105d33cd57819fd

2 Input
2 Outputs
  • 58254e1433244d1fd9599358611a5288a29dd70cf01b442b5105d33cd57819fd:0
  • value  530000
    address  3KSn1YdfZMP5zRTUMzaqw8cr4K4afJHc55
  • 58254e1433244d1fd9599358611a5288a29dd70cf01b442b5105d33cd57819fd:1
  • value  519300
    address  3BW8BG6g3DuAP6DrTzjVuJBNDzLx4rG9z4